Wearing Socks and Slides: Trend and History

Over 2000 years ago, the Romans wore socks with sandals.  There is evidence of socks sewn with a split toe to accommodate the sandal post that fits between your big toe and the next four. (Source: Wikipedia).

In 2010, runway models started wearing socks with sandals.  The Daily Telegraph reported that “Socks and sandals are on trend for spring/summer 2010. Prior to this, socks were considered a faux pas.  How times slowly change. LOL.

In a news article, The Evening Sun depicts the custom of socks and sandals fashion among the old generation. According to Brian Shea, once it was popular among the Germans.

In the Pacific Northwest regions, a digital media company, The Daily Dot highlighted that the term “Socks and Sandals” entered into the search engine mostly by the Washingtonians.

Comfort

Some people wear socks with their slides because it’s just comfortable. The socks prevent your feet from rubbing against the slides (and therefore potentially prevents blisters).

As we put on shoes for the sake of comfort, wearing socks with slides is not a bad trend at all for extra-comfort.

Hygiene

Some men wear socks and slides for hygiene purposes. Women are more conscious about their beauty, but men are not so much.

Wearing socks with your slides can protect your toes, wick away moisture from your feet and generally help with foot hygiene.
